Learnbot, if you setup message alerts on your watch list then there will be a time stamp in the Message Center as new stocks are added to the list. I think it can also be set to send emails, text messages at the time as well. There may be a network delay between the phone.

Left click on the watch list name area as you would when changing lists / creating new / etc. I think this only applies to scan list and not just a watch list. You should see the option more than half way down to create alerts - alert when scan results change. It alerted me of MXC at 9:31 am EST.

A little insight from my point of view. The big runners are the obvious premarket movers that have continued onto the morning session. Rv1 is probably over 20 and heading higher. The bigger the news the bigger the move. Anything with an Rv1 over 100 is usually the best bet to trade. (remember that the morning session is split into a few intervals, so just because a stock didnt blast off after the bell rings doesnt mean it won't eventually)

With that being said, I have noticed that the ones that populate the watchlist after 10am are the ones to scalp in and out. Rv1 around 5 to 6 and heading up is a good sign. From my experience so far I would say anywhere between $0.15 to $0.60 is what I would aim for. No big dollar moves here, but a reliable money maker none the less.

A little off topic here, but for higher float stocks like aapl, msft, intc etc... An Rv1 over 1 is basically the equivalent to a higher Rv1 on low floats. It signals that the stock is trading on higher than normal volume. This tends to lend itself for option traders as the higher the volume the bigger the swings on value are per contract.

To attach a screenshot, go to IMGUR.com. You do not need to set up an account. In the upper left, there will be a green box that says "new post". Upload the screenshot, at each screenshot, upper right-hand corner of the picture, it will say copy post. Click on "post to BB". Next, copy the URL and come back to this site. Then click on the insert link above, not picture. Paste in the URL box and click insert.
